🍣
プログラマーとは
プログラムを作る作業をプログラミングと呼び、それができる人をプログラマーと呼ぶ
プログラムを書く作業をコーディングと呼び、それができる人をコーダーと呼ぶ
コードを書くだけの人は、プログラマーではなく、単なるコーダー
コードを書く、という作業自体に、そもそも大した付加価値はない
「読みやすく」「拡張性の高い」「良いアルゴリズムを使った」コードを書けるだけの人は、どんなに頑張ってもスーパーコーダー
「コーディング作業」は、AIによって、どんどん自動化されていく
スーパーコーダーも、AIに太刀打ち打出来なくなる
文章も同じ
文章を書けない人はいない
でも、物語を書ける人、小説を書ける人は、ほんの一握り
では、プログラマーとは?
プログラミングという手段を使って、作品を生み出すことができる人たち
プランナー(企画者)は、様々な想像をして企画を立案するが、それを実現する為には、お金を集めて人を雇って、他人の協力を得なければならない
小説を作れない人、プログラムを作れない人は他人の力を借りなければ作品を作れない
でも、プログラマーは、自分で想像したものは、自分で作ればよい
自分の脳みそとPCがあれば、お金がなくても、作品を作り出すことができる
プログラムを書くだけでなく、想像すること作品を作り出すこと
コーダーとプログラマーの違いはここにある
プログラマーという人種は、素晴らしい!
まあ、ビジネスとして成功するかどうかは別だけどね
Discussion